LAWS OF MARYLAND.

Make tunnel.

 

and in making their said Road to construct the
same in a tunnel; and, whereas, the construc-
tion of the said tunnel involves a large and
heavy cost, Be it enacted, That so much of the
fifteenth Section of the said Act, passed at Jan-
uary Session, eighteen hundred and fifty-three,
Chapter one hundred and ninety-four, entitled
"An Act to Incorporate the Baltimore and Poto-
mac Railroad Company," as provides that the
said Company shall have power to charge for tolls
upon and the transportation of persons, goods,
produce, merchandise, or property of any descrip-
tion transported by them on said Railroad or
Railroads, any sum not exceeding eight cents per

Tolls.

ton for both tolls, and transportation for every
mile the same maybe transported, and for passen-
gers not exceeding four cents per mile for each
passenger, shall not apply to the transportation
of persons, goods, produce, merchandise, or prop-
erty of any description transported on the said
Railroad between the points on the line of the
Northern Central Railway, as newly located,
where the said Baltimore and Potomac Railroad
commences, and the point where the said Bal-
more and Potomac Railroad, as now located,

Boundary of
road.

crosses the western boundary of the City of
Baltimore; but the said Company shall have
power to charge for tolls upon and the trans-
portation of persons, goods, produce, merchan-
dise, or property of any description transported
by them on said Railroad between the points
on the line of the Northern Central Railway, as
newly located, where the said Baltimore and Po-
tomac Railroad commences and the point where
the said Baltimore and Potomac Railroad, as now
located, crosses the western boundary of the City
of Baltimore, or any portion of the distance be-
tween the said points, any sum not exceeding the
rate of twenty-five cents per ton, for both tolls
and transportation, for every mile or proportion-

Rates of pas-
sage.

ate part of a mile the same may be transported,
and for passengers not exceeding the rate of fifty
cents per mile, or proportionate part of a mile,
for each passenger; provided, however, that the
Western Maryland Railroad Company and the
Union Railroad Company shall have the right to
use the said Road for the passage of locomotives
